It came in the mail today!! I waited all day long, pacing the floors.. But it finally arrived. Just in the nick of time too! The rain was starting to move in.. Of COURSE it only does that when I get a saddle to try.. What are they called saddle gnomes.. :cool:

Anyways first impressions were that it was REALLY well made. Love the leather, soft and buttery with a nice grip to it. Light weight!! Love that it is only 7 lbs.. I am a little leery of the sympanova, but was assured that it would hold up in the Florida heat!!

They sent me the wrong size seat, but that's ok, I can get the other seat shortly.. I thought it felt BIG for a 17.5, but it was an 18. Supper soft, and squishy.. Love the seat, it is really nice.. It is about the only treeless saddle that I have found to have a twist to it. My leg hung done really nicely, no charlie horses..

My horse LOVED it too. He was forward and happy, even with the weather rolling in. Rain storms tend to make him a little LOOPY.. He hates to get wet!! :p I could sit his trot well, and the canter was ooooo so dreamy.. He is very springy, and I found that the Liberty absorbed a lot of the concussion.

He can play a pretty good rendition of a PUFFERFISH!! so when I bent down to check the girth.. I could get a small cat thru it.. The saddle NEVER budged.. Thank God for all that Bareback riding..!!:D Tightened the girth back up, and away we went..

I LOVED the knee blocks.. They helped but did not hinder.. They were just kinda there. Which was really nice. I am going to see what happens if I move the seat up a little bit, then I can use the knee block a little more. That's a great option. Not only can you adjust the stirrups to where you want them, but you can move the seat up or back, about an inch!! Cool!!:D

The flap is a nice length for my petite self, even thought I have a long leg. I am kinda like Kermit the frog.. :rolleyes:

I give this saddle a totally THUMBS up!! and I am TOTALLY keeping it..

I have tried the London, Fhoenix, Sensation, Cheyenne( I still have the Cheyenne, and LOVE that one too) and now the Liberty!!

To date the Liberty is my favorite.

I am using the Christ treeless pad, with 3/4 inch laminated skito inserts, with shoulder shims.. And a Fleece girth. I switched the fleece girth out for my wintec neoprene girth and it went much better. I could get the girth tigher, and I had NO slipping problems.. I must not have had the girth done up tight enough yesterday!!
